Title : Effects of luteolin on spatial memory, cell proliferation, and neuroblast differentiation in the hippocampal dentate gyrus in a scopolamine-induced amnesia model - Yoo_2013_Neurol.Res_35_813 |
Author(s) : Yoo DY , Choi JH , Kim W , Nam SM , Jung HY , Kim JH , Won MH , Yoon YS , Hwang IK |
Ref : Neurol Res , 35 :813 , 2013 |
Abstract :
OBJECTIVES: Luteolin, a common flavonoid from many plants, has various pharmacological activities, including a memory-improving effect. In this study, we investigated the effects of luteolin on spatial memory, cell proliferation, and neuroblast differentiation in the hippocampal dentate gyrus in a rat model of scopolamine (SCO)-induced amnesia. |
